Term: 1-methyltryptophan
Accession: CHEBI:72821
browse the term
Definition: A tryptophan derivative that is tryptophan carrying a single methyl substituent at position 1 on the indole.
Synonyms: related_synonym: 1-methyl-DL-tryptophan; Formula=C12H14N2O2; InChI=1S/C12H14N2O2/c1-14-7-8(6-10(13)12(15)16)9-4-2-3-5-11(9)14/h2-5,7,10H,6,13H2,1H3,(H,15,16); InChIKey=ZADWXFSZEAPBJS-UHFFFAOYSA-N; N-methyl-DL-tryptophan; N-methyltryptophan; SMILES=Cn1cc(CC(N)C(O)=O)c2ccccc12
